<content:encoded><![CDATA[<div class='snap_preview'><p>Popular teen-themed channel 4 television show <em>Skins</em> is due to begin broadcasting its fourth series in January 2010. The show, which began broadcasting on digital station E4 in 2007, has built up a large number of devoted fans. Every two years the cast is replaced with a new set of core characters. <em>About A Boy</em> star Nicholas Hoult starred in the first series as Tony Stonem. The new series will be the last featuring the current cast, which includes Kaya Scodelario as Effy Stonem. There will be eight episodes in the new series. The show is also a hit in the states where an American version, set in Baltimore, is currently in development. A big screen version may also soon be made as it was announced, in May 2009, that Film4 and Skins production company, Company Pictures, are in preliminary talks about producing one. I&#8217;m looking forward to the new series and will be disappointed if it proves to be the last one they make. <p>There is no question that I have been highly critical of Dexter this season, which isn&#8217;t to suggest that I wasn&#8217;t also critical of season two (where the conclusion fizzled) or season three (where things felt as if they wrapped up too neatly): this is a show that I have always felt struggled in the balance between the parts and the whole, and this has been especially clear this season. While I&#8217;ve enjoyed the majority of the story surrounding the Trinity Killer, and Michael C. Hall is delivering as compelling a performance as ever, I&#8217;ve found myself watching episodes out of obligation more than interest, and fastforwarding through anything not involving Trinity, Dexter, or Deb.</p>
<p>If we follow that strategy, &#8220;Hungry Man&#8221; contains perhaps the best connection yet between Dexter and Trinity, offering glimpses of two theoretically similar Thanksgiving dinners that in reality tell two very different story or, more problematically for Dexter, two very different stages of the same tale. The problem is that this isn&#8217;t actually a new theme, having effectively been the purpose of the Trinity story since we meant &#8220;Arthur,&#8221; and despite some really fantastic execution throughout it (like seasons before it) feels a bit too on the nose, thematically.</p>
<p>However, when you have a show that likes to meander about as it does and (in my opinion) waste our time with storylines that are irrelevant until the show decides to deliver a bombshell like at the end of this episode, I&#8217;ll take compelling contrivance over mundane mind games any day.</p>
<p><!--more--></p>
<p>What bugs me about showing the dangerous side of the Mitchell family is that it was so inevitable. The storyline has always been an extravagant excuse to investigate Dexter&#8217;s family more carefully, a conveniently Miami-based serial killer who happens to also have a family. Over the past number of episodes, the show has created excuses for Dexter to see what Arthur is made of, discovering last week that he&#8217;s not even close to stable and discovering this week that his family has consequently suffered. And in those scenes the show has created a lot of legitimate dramatic tension, as Arthur/Trinity is unpredictable in a way that Dexter simply isn&#8217;t. We know how Dexter responds to situations, and we&#8217;re so far inside his head that the show has felt the need to more consistently use Harry as a second voice in order to diversify his inner monologues. To have a new character who is similarly complex to be able to investigate is both useful for Dexter (who loves self-inflicting psychoanalysis) and for the show, and Lithgow has been a great addition as a result.</p>
<p>However, my problem is that this episode goes too far to vilify Arthur, to take him so far away from Dexter&#8217;s current position that he becomes simply a cautionary tale rather than a complex individual to be dissected by Dexter and by the audience. It&#8217;s one thing to shatter his image of the perfect family by suggesting that his son resents him for the emergence of his violent tendencies, or to suggest that he is over-protective of his daughter to the point where he locks her in her room and has effectively turned her into both a creepily sexual 15-year old and a replacement for his dead sister. I think those cracks in the perfect family were both really interesting (especially with the daughter, who until this episode seemed a waste of the acting talents Vanessa Marano showed on Six Feet Under or Gilmore Girls), and they created consequences that wouldn&#8217;t be visible from behind a tree in his front yard, Dexter&#8217;s first vantage point into this family.</p>
<p>And yet, when Jonah went off during Thanksgiving dinner and Arthur went on a murderous rampage choking out his son and throwing his daughter across the room, the scene went too far. Yes, the scene was an enormously compelling piece of drama, and we&#8217;re conditioned to gasp when Dexter reveals the Dark Passenger to Arthur in that moment, but it makes things far too easy, which is the same thing that has happened in every past season. In Season Two, Lyla was a lifeline for Dexter, someone that he was able to talk to about his problem (albeit veiled in the context of Narcotics Anonymous), and killing someone who offers him solace would have been an intriguing moral dilemma; of course, she turned into a kidnapping arsonist psychopath, so all questions of morality disappeared. The same happened in Season Three when Dexter found Miguel Prado, someone who could be a friend and confidante who knew about his problems but understood and even assisted with it; however, he was revealed to be a corrupt attorney who was using Dexter to kill innocent victims, which made Dexter&#8217;s decision to kill him less morally complicated and more &#8220;satisfying.&#8221; It was a &#8220;Hell yeah&#8221; moment on a show that, late in each season, loves shifting into that mode.</p>
<p>For once, I&#8217;d like to see one of Dexter&#8217;s foils actually remain complicated to the point where Dexter doesn&#8217;t know if he should kill them. I&#8217;m aware that Trinity doesn&#8217;t make a great candidate for this considering the fact that he has murdered nearly 100 people in his lifetime, but having Dexter witness it first hand in such vivid detail creates too simple a trajectory. Dexter is at its best when it is investigating moral complexities, in particular within Dexter, and that ship has officially sailed: from now on, we&#8217;ve switched from being compelled by the intricacies of this friendship to a sort of bloodlust, hopeful that Dexter &#8220;gets another kill&#8221; (a common complaint amongst some fans is that they aren&#8217;t satisfied unless Dexter draws blood). The scene was enormously compelling, don&#8217;t get me wrong, but it also signals that the compelling series of episodes more carefully investigating Arthur have passed, and a serial killer is effectively all that&#8217;s left.</p>
<p>I thought that this hour was one of the best so far this season in terms of connecting Trinity and Dexter&#8217;s experiences, and Harry&#8217;s observation that Rita was, at one point, also just a cover for his true identity is spot on. Dexter has been holding onto hope that Arthur somehow figured it out, but in this episode any sense that Arthur has anything under control was eliminated as soon as his family was revealed as so tragically flawed. While it involved one of the subplots I fastforwarded through (Elliot and Rita&#8217;s transgression), it was interesting to see how Dexter returns to his family and sees what he believes to be happiness (Cody volunteering thanks for Dexter, the same thanks that had to be coerced out of the Millers) when in reality Elliot has whispered in Rita&#8217;s ear that Dexter isn&#8217;t around as much as a real father should be. It allows Dexter to believe his family is different when, based on what we know (and what Dexter should know, considering Rita&#8217;s less than stable past) there is every chance that ten years down the line they could be just the same.</p>
<p>But, unfortunately for the season as a whole, this is as far as this investigation is really going to get, if we follow the traditional patterns of the season structures (which, as noted, to this point have been almost slavishly adhered to). While we learn that Christine is Trinity&#8217;s daughter, and Deb puts together that she was likely the person who shot her and killed Lundy, we&#8217;re entering into the part of the season that completely demystifies the villains in an effort to allow Dexter to be a hero. Now, killing Trinity is avenging the thirty years of murders, protecting against future murders, protecting the Miller family, and protecting himself (now that Arthur knows his inner demon); there&#8217;s nothing complex about that, an inevitability tied as much to Lithgow&#8217;s guest star status as it is to the show&#8217;s ongoing pattern.</p>
<p>And if this was all surrounded by a more compelling set of ancillary storylines, I&#8217;d probably be less likely to complain about it, but forgive me if Batista/LaGuerta and Quinn/Reporter aren&#8217;t doing it for me.</p>

<p>This is &#8220;Green Week&#8221; on NBC, which means that every show has some sort of environmental sustainability storyline in it. And while the shows did similar episodes a few seasons ago (The Office did its &#8220;Survivorman&#8221; parody and 30 Rock did the great &#8220;Greenzo&#8221;), it&#8217;s a well that has quite a bit of content in it, depending on how the shows wants to go about it.</p>
<p>While The Office (which I won&#8217;t be reviewing tonight, although I&#8217;ll probably throw some thoughts onto the end of the page) simply used it as a theme for the cold open (as it did with Halloween), 30 Rock takes a more continuous and as a result scattered approach. Giving Kenneth the task of &#8220;greening&#8221; 30 Rock felt forced, and while the episode wanted to try to make it seem subversive and clever the show has done too many similar things before.</p>
<p>However, continuing last week&#8217;s improvement on the season as a whole, this week had a cohesive point of view if we ignore the environmental side of things, presenting two stories that allowed for both some brilliant absurdity and actions which are driven by character rather than plot. And, just when you think that the environmental story is entirely worthless, the show spins off a few random parts of other scenes into the storyline and helps bring everything full circle in a sequence that actually is as clever as it wants it to be.</p>
<p>Plus, Teddy Ruxpin was a frakkin&#8217; lawyer.</p>
<p><!--more--></p>
<p>Yes, that was really the episode&#8217;s highlight: the idea that Kathy Geiss was being represented in a court of law by a talking Teddy Ruxpin doll who simply wants to be the media&#8217;s friend. It was the season&#8217;s most hilarious cutaway, the kind of scene that makes you pause and laugh, which is what 30 Rock needs when its plots aren&#8217;t working as well as they could. Ultimately here, Jack&#8217;s story was actually quite strong, as the public scandal facing Don Geiss forces him to consider avoiding having children in order to ensure he has no similar situations in his future. If Jack had been in the storyline alone, perhaps it would have been too simple, but pairing him with Tracy (who always wants a vasectomy so that he can tell dirty stories) is always, always a good idea. Morgan and Baldwin play off of each other amazingly well, and they had some great material here.</p>
<p>Baldwin was strong throughout, sure, but I definitely think Morgan was the star here. I got a huge kick out of the &#8220;I know what that means&#8221;/&#8221;Then why won&#8217;t you tell me?!&#8221; exchange between Tracy and Tracy Jr., and the &#8220;Well I hope he made me an Acrosshelmet too&#8221; line was a stroke of genius. I like these stories because they humanize characters that are both heartless and absurd at the same time, and while this was no &#8220;Rosemary&#8217;s Baby&#8221; I thought that both actors were having a lot of fun, and anything that involves Dr. Leo Spaceman (who didn&#8217;t get a huge one-liner [okay, "what about CHEERS lied to me" killed] but did get a number of marvelous line ridings for Chris Parnell) is going to be worth our time.</p>
<p>As for Liz&#8217;s central storyline, it was well-executed and I enjoyed Nate Corddry. It&#8217;s not what one would call the most well-developed storyline in the world, but I enjoyed how its simple structure kept escalating as Liz goes through all of her known strategies for getting people out of apartments, discovering along the way that this guy happens to be immune to all of them. I was particularly taken with Dot Com&#8217;s performance as an angry ex-boyfriend, primarily because of the continuity of his desire to be taken as a serious actor, and also because of his <a href="http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Warren_Moon#Personal_life">obscure Warren Moon reference</a>. Yes, &#8220;Episode 210&#8243; did &#8220;Liz Buys an Apartment&#8221; better, but the final resolution (&#8220;The Frank&#8221;) working and giving her a chance to create a two-level apartment (and tying in an earlier scene that seemed odd otherwise) finished a storyline that was on occasion very funny and throughout a fine comic showcase for Tina Fey&#8217;s ability to ham it up a little.</p>
<p>As for Kenneth&#8217;s green challenge, it was clever throughout which is all you can really ask. I&#8217;m more than tired of the show winking to the audience, like the &#8220;Green Peacock&#8221; moment, but I thought two things worked really well. The first were the two NBC Celebrity pamphlets: they were really simple jokes, but having Kenneth read them out really made them hit home, and I particularly found the FNL one (&#8220;My show is about football. There&#8217;s a football team called the Chargers. You should unplug your chargers&#8221;) funny for some reason. And, most importantly for the storyline, it ended with another appearance by Al Gore, which was certainly more instructive (to the point of feeling preachy) but then ended on a joke that was too cute by half, but so cute that it didn&#8217;t matter. The recycling (get it? GET IT?!) of the joke from &#8220;Greenzo&#8221; was a nice touch, and if they&#8217;re going to preach I&#8217;d rather they do it with a wink like that.</p>
<p>Not brilliance, but a couple of big laughs and some nice storyline balance &#8211; I&#8217;ll take it.</p>

<content:encoded><![CDATA[<div class='snap_preview'><p>Isn&#8217;t that an oxymoron or something? Seriously, &#8220;Training&#8221; (is all about the preparation for races where performance isn&#8217;t important) and &#8220;Races&#8221; (what training is all about and based purely on performance) It doesn&#8217;t make sense &#8230;..</p>
<p>Hmmm wait,  I think I get it, it must mean training for races? like simulating races, tactics and gaining experiences, but at a time where performance is not important &#8230;.. buuuuut its still a RACE and there are competitors and ranking so how can results not matter?!</p>
<p>Anyways, I get confused thinking too much into it so I do what all &#8216;good&#8217; athletes do:  Just put my head down and grind away! which is actually a lot tougher than it seems &#8230;</p>
<p>For me, its deciding if I want to go all out or not because I know training races aren&#8217;t target races and there are always a millions excuses that can be used (&#8220;I&#8217;m not tapered&#8217;, &#8216;tough workouts last week&#8217;, &#8216;went out drinking last night&#8217;, &#8216;didn&#8217;t sleep well&#8217;, &#8216;just got back last night&#8217;, etc) to have a sub-par performance.  Mentally and physically it takes a lot out of me to put everything on the line and fight for every second or achieve a few higher spots when I know I haven&#8217;t done any or very little preparation for the race&#8230;</p>
<p>It&#8217;s like going into a final exam knowing that even if I get a 100% on the final I am still going to fail the course because I didn&#8217;t do the homework, participate, and failed the mid term.  Does it really matter if I get 100% or 75% or even 50% on the final? &#8230;. Its easy to put 100% or even a 110% going into the final exam or racing a target race when the preparation is done and there no excuses.</p>
<p>Well, yesterday I decided that even if I was going to &#8220;fail the course&#8217; I may as well go out with a bang&#8221;! Yesterday was the <a title="NB Fall Classic" href="http://www.fallclassicrun.com/" target="_blank">NB Fall Classic</a> (Half marathon, 10km or 5km), which I have raced the 10km the last 2 years, but and Coach Alan and I decided to try something a little different and race the half since we weren&#8217;t focusing on the 10km run right now and have a little &#8216;fun&#8217; &#8230;</p>
<p>And I think I went out with a bang cause I am barely making it up and down stairs today!! I fought hard for a few minutes faster and maybe a couple positions better &#8230;.  I know it doesn&#8217;t really matter in the big picture, but it taught me a little more about myself : )</p>
<p>For one OW! and secondly I am sooo glad I don&#8217;t train for long course triathlons! Kudos to those that do, cause I the half marathon alone was long and gruelling. The 10km definitely burns a lot more in the short term, but the half is just taxing &#8230;. and after an easy ride in the afternoon afterwards to &#8216;loosen up&#8217; I am barely walking today!  A half-ironman seems like a looong way! I think I&#8217;ll stick with the intensity and short course triathlons for now &#8230;. one day I&#8217;ll get there tho ; )</p>
<p>Result: 1:26:41 &#8211; 3rd Women Overall</p>

<content:encoded><![CDATA[<div class='snap_preview'><p>First monday after a while without the new episode of mad men. Every sunday evening aired in US on MNC, thus early monday morning a copy of the show usually reaches the rest of the world though internet. It is currently the only series about the world of marketers and advertisers for all the sympathetics. Mad men is set in the 1960s, initially at the fictional Sterling Cooper advertising agency on Madison Ave, NY. The show centers on Don Draper, creative director and those in his life in and out of the office. It also depicts the changing social norms of 1960s America. In few first seasons Mad man has received critical acclaim for its historical authenticity and visual style, as well winning several important awards, including Emmy award for outstanding drama series and three Golden Globes.</p>
<p>Last week I have witnessed excellent finale of the third season in its last episode &#8211; &#8220;Shut the door and have a seat&#8221;. One can learn a lot about business world watching it. Human brain plays out to be a key asset in an advertising agency or any other knowledge based firm, and Sterling Cooper owners PPL could not manage resource mobility issues even through binding employment contracts to sustain creative brain/client relationship advantages. Interaction of formal vs. informal organization, equity ownership as insufficient governance tool, motivation for cooperation aspect, &#8211; all crisp and clear leads to what&#8217;s inescapable. Sterling Cooper might be gone, but the key players can always start over and do a better job at Sterling Cooper Draper Price. Over the end credits of the show, Roy Orbison sings, &#8220;The future is much better than the past.&#8221; We shall see.</p>
